Version: [5345] 3D OSM Model 0.16.0

- **Pedestrian squares & plazas:** pedestrian/footway *areas*
(`highway=pedestrian`/`footway` with `area=yes`), town squares
(`place=square`) and marketplaces are now drawn as flat paved
**stone** ground (a new `pedestrian` block style, lighter than the
asphalt of car parks). Previously a pedestrian area fell through to
the road branch and was drawn as a thin **ring tracing its outline**
instead of a filled square — a real correctness fix, not just new
coverage. An ordinary `highway=pedestrian` way *without* `area=yes` is
a pedestrian street and still renders as a road. Verified by the node
`defaultBlockCategoryStyle` harness
(pedestrian/plaza/square/marketplace → stone, never green or a road)
and the qgis-stubbed routing test (a pedestrian *area* → blocks, a
pedestrian *street* → roads).
